The Enigma of the Hidden Kitchen

In the heart of a quaint, ancient village nestled between rolling hills and whispering forests, there lay a garden that was whispered about in hushed tones. The locals spoke of it with reverence, a place where the ordinary became extraordinary, and the simple became divine. This was the Gourmet Garden, a chef's secret hideout, shrouded in mystery and steeped in folklore.

The story began with a young boy named Ming, whose family had lived in the village for generations. Ming was an inquisitive soul, always drawn to the tales of the Gourmet Garden, which his grandmother would recount with a twinkle in her eye. She spoke of the garden's hidden entrance, guarded by ancient oaks and a gate that seemed to move with the wind. She told of the chef who lived there, a master of flavors, who could transform the simplest of ingredients into works of art.

One fateful day, Ming's curiosity got the better of him. He decided to explore the garden, convinced that the legends were mere fabrications of the villagers' imaginations. As he ventured deeper into the forest, the trees seemed to part before him, revealing a narrow path that led to the garden's entrance. The gate, which had been still moments before, now swung open with a gentle creak.

Inside, Ming was greeted by a breathtaking sight. The garden was a paradise of vibrant colors, with flowers of every hue imaginable and a small, quaint kitchen at its center. The air was thick with the scent of herbs and spices, and Ming could hear the soft hum of music, as if the garden itself was alive with a hidden rhythm.

As Ming wandered through the garden, he came upon an old man, tending to the plants with a gentle hand. The man's eyes twinkled with wisdom, and when he saw Ming, he smiled warmly.

"Welcome, young one," the old man said. "I am Chef Li, the guardian of this garden. I have been waiting for you."

Ming was taken aback by the old man's words, but his curiosity was piqued. "I don't understand," he said. "Why would you wait for me?"

Chef Li chuckled softly. "The garden is not just a place of beauty; it is a place of secrets. And you, Ming, are the one chosen to unlock them."

With that, Chef Li led Ming to the kitchen, where a wooden table was set with an array of ingredients. "Here," Chef Li said, "is the secret recipe that has been passed down through generations. It is the key to the garden's magic."

Ming watched as Chef Li began to prepare a dish, using ingredients that seemed ordinary but were transformed into something extraordinary. The flavors were rich and complex, and Ming could taste the history and heart of the garden in every bite.

As the dish was completed, Chef Li placed it before Ming. "Eat it, and you will understand."

Ming took a bite, and his world was forever changed. The flavors were like nothing he had ever tasted before, and he felt a surge of energy and clarity. He realized that the garden was not just a place of beauty but a place of wisdom and connection to the earth.

Chef Li smiled. "Now, you must go back to your village and share this knowledge. The garden will not be complete until its magic is spread far and wide."

Ming nodded, understanding the gravity of Chef Li's words. He left the garden, the gate swinging shut behind him, and made his way back to the village.

When Ming arrived, he was greeted by his family, who had been worried sick. He didn't waste any time in sharing his incredible experience with them. The village was abuzz with excitement as Ming began to share the secrets of the Gourmet Garden, teaching the villagers how to grow their own herbs and spices and how to cook with the same passion and precision as Chef Li.

The village flourished, and the Gourmet Garden's magic spread like wildfire. The once-ordinary became extraordinary, and the simple became divine. And all because of a young boy's curiosity and the ancient wisdom of Chef Li.

Years passed, and Ming became a legend in his own right, known far and wide for his culinary prowess. But he never forgot the garden that had changed his life, or the old man who had shown him the way.

And so, the Gourmet Garden remained a secret, hidden away in the heart of the forest, a place of magic and mystery, waiting for the next chosen one to unlock its secrets and spread its magic.
